70Xi analyzer benefits Fastest speed of any automatic or manual method: Average test duration 5 10 min Average operator time 0.5 2 min Easy and fast to use saves time in the lab Best overall precision of any automatic or manual ASTM method Powerful cooling system; minimum sample temperature to below -88 C [-126 F]

70Xi productivity features Fast, one-touch testing press one button to run a test instead of entering multiple screens of information Full-color, touch-sensitive, 15 high resolution screen Easier to read and view more information Displays several views of information at the same time. Touch sensitive design is faster than keyboard & mouse. Easy-to-use interface New colorful graphic icon buttons for faster navigation. Intuitive and easy to understand on-screen prompts.

70Xi productivity features USB and Ethernet connectivity Quickly export analyzer data to a portable USB flash drive. Ethernet port available for connecting to LIMS or internal computer network Import and store any user documents (.doc,.pdf,.ppt and.pps) for customized operating procedures (SOP) or training Reliability improvements Modular component design boards can be easily replaced in the field; no need to return to Canada for service More stable cooler Faster multiprocessor

70Xi intellinostics Built-in answers and operator information Quick, responsive solutions built-in alert messages give troubleshooting options to quickly solve problems Self-guided tutorials easy, on-screen instructions show how to use analyzer In-depth system diagnostics system checks verify performance and detect problems with critical components

Phase Technology 70Xi Autosampler System

Automatic sampling & cleaning Set-and-forget convenience set 1 to 48 test runs, then walk away and let the analyzer do the rest! Automatic sample injection no need to individually pipette samples or change pipette tips. Always uses the exact amount of sample required by the ASTM method. Self-cleaning Saves time and ensures perfect cleaning every time. No more need for cotton swabs or risk of damage to sample cup.

CLOUD POINT ASTM Method Comparison Phase Technology 70Xi ISL CPP 5Gs ISL MPP 5Gs Tanaka MPC-102 Manual Method ASTM Cloud Point Method D5773 D5771 D7689 D7683 D2500 Repeatability 1.3 C 2.2 C 1.0 C 1.47 C 2 C Reproducibility 2.5 C 3.9 C 2.8 C 2.45 C 4 C Test bias relative to manual method Test duration Temperature range No Yes: -0.56 C Yes significant bias detected: -1.23 C Yes significant bias detected: 1.68 C 5 to 10 minutes 30-45 minutes 30-45 minutes 45 to 60 minutes 60+ minutes -88 C to +55 C -95 to +51ºC -95 C to +45 C -30 C to +51 C* -65 C to +51 C (external cooler) Sample volume 0.15 ml 15 ml 1 ml 4.5 ml External cooler or bath required no no no Yes* (*air cooled model available) N/A yes

CLOUD POINT ASTM Method Comparison ISL CPP-5Gs Worst precision of any automatic method Requires significant amount of time for sample preparation; water bath or oven must be used to bring sample to at least 14 C above the expected cloud point. ISL MPP-5Gs Interlaboratory Round Robin results showed there is a statistically significant bias of 1.23 C relative to ASTM D2500. Slow test speed Phase Technology 70Xi can perform at least five test runs in the time that it takes MPP-5Gs to perform one single test!

CLOUD POINT ASTM Method Comparison Tanaka MPC-102 Interlaboratory Round Robin results showed there is a statistically significant bias of 1.68 C relative to ASTM D2500. Tanaka is the slowest automatic method takes almost as long as the manual method. The MPC-102 requires 4 ml of sample (complare to Phase Technology use of 0.15 ml). Larger sample volume introduces nonuniform temperature. Even with external liquid cooler, MPC-102 is not able to reach the low temperature level that Phase Technology does. Tanaka is only capable of going down to -30 C with internal cooler Phase Technology reaches -88 C with internal cooler
